本考案は線材コイルの集束装置、特に疵発生の少ない線
材コイルの集束装置に関するものである。DETAILED DESCRIPTION OF THE INVENTION The present invention relates to a wire coil focusing device, and more particularly to a wire coil focusing device with less occurrence of flaws.
近年、鋼線材の製造方法として線材圧延工程とこれに続
く熱処理工程を直結した効率的な方式が種々採用される
に至っている。In recent years, various efficient methods have been adopted as methods for producing steel wire rods, in which a wire rod rolling process and a subsequent heat treatment process are directly connected.
この方式では最終圧延機を出た線材は、水冷装置を経て
レイング式巻取機によってリング状にされて次の搬送コ
ンベア(チェンコンベア、ローラコンベア等)上に落下
され、該コンベア上を各リングが非同心の重合状態で展
開されつつ搬送され、搬送中に所望の冷却速度で冷却さ
れた後、コンベア終端で線材集束装置(集束タブ、集束
キャリア)に集束され、次工程へ移送する各工程から構
成される。In this method, the wire rod exiting the final rolling mill passes through a water cooling device, is made into a ring shape by a laying type winder, and is dropped onto the next conveyor (chain conveyor, roller conveyor, etc.), and each ring is passed on the conveyor. The wire rods are conveyed while unfolding in a non-concentric polymerized state, and after being cooled at the desired cooling rate during conveyance, they are bundled into a wire convergence device (convergence tab, convergence carrier) at the end of the conveyor, and transferred to the next process. It consists of
集束された線材コイルは次いで別位置にて検査、秤量等
の工程を経て最終的に結束された後、適宜の輸送手段に
積込まれて出荷される。The bundled wire rod coils are then subjected to inspection, weighing, and other processes at another location, and finally bundled, and then loaded onto a suitable means of transportation and shipped.
しかして、成品として搬出されるコイルはその品質面か
らできるだけ疵の少ないことが当然要求され、このため
線材の製造過程における疵発生については改良が種々な
されているが、線材の疵発生は線材コイル集束後におい
ても各種原因によって起りうる問題であり、従来ではこ
の集束後の疵発生に関してはほとんど効果的な手段が施
されていなかったのが実情であり。Naturally, coils shipped as finished products are required to have as few defects as possible in terms of quality, and for this reason various improvements have been made to reduce the occurrence of defects in the manufacturing process of wire rods. This problem can occur due to various causes even after focusing, and the reality is that in the past, almost no effective measures have been taken to prevent the occurrence of flaws after focusing.
すなわち、コイル集束後の疵発生について詳細に検討し
てみると、流発生原因としては結束フープ材とコイルと
の接触、コイル相互の接触、コイル移送用フックのコイ
ルへの突掛け、集束キャリア接触等が挙げられる。In other words, when we examine in detail the occurrence of flaws after coil focusing, we find that the causes of flow are contact between the binding hoop material and the coil, contact between the coils, contact between the coil transfer hook and the coil, and contact with the focusing carrier. etc.
また、疵発生部位では、第1図に示す結束フープ材1で
直接結束した線材コイル2においては、特にコイル両端
面a、l)での疵発生率が全体に半分近くを占めている
ことが明らかとなった。In addition, in the wire coil 2 directly bound with the binding hoop material 1 shown in Fig. 1, the occurrence rate of flaws at both ends of the coil (a, l) accounts for nearly half of the total. It became clear.
このコイル両端面の疵は、フープ材とコイルとの接触、
コイル相互の接触(コイル積重ねた時)およびフックに
よる突掛は等の原因で生ずるものと考えられる。This flaw on both ends of the coil is caused by contact between the hoop material and the coil.
Contact between the coils (when the coils are stacked) and hooks caused by the hooks are thought to be caused by the following reasons.
本考案は以上の点に鑑みコイル両端面の疵発生を防止し
これにより線材の品質向上を計ることができる線材コイ
ルの集束装置を提供することを目的とする。In view of the above points, it is an object of the present invention to provide a wire coil convergence device that can prevent the occurrence of flaws on both end faces of the coil and thereby improve the quality of the wire.
また、本考案の他の目的は、従来の線材め集束工程を何
ら変更することなく容易に流発生防止工程を組み込むこ
とができる極めて能率的な線材コイルの集束設備(工程
)を提供することにある。Another object of the present invention is to provide extremely efficient wire coil focusing equipment (process) that can easily incorporate a flow prevention process without any changes to the conventional wire focusing process. be.

第2図は線材巻取機3の後方に配置した線材搬送コンベ
ア(冷却作用を果たす)4の終端近傍に保護材供給装置
5を設置した例を示す。FIG. 2 shows an example in which a protective material supply device 5 is installed near the end of a wire rod conveyor 4 (which performs a cooling function) placed behind the wire winder 3.
前記搬送コンベア4の終端下方には落下してくる線材リ
ングを受ける集束装置(集束タブ)6が設けられ、前記
供給装置5は同じく該集束タブ6に対してコイル端面保
護材を供給するものである。A convergence device (convergence tab) 6 is provided below the terminal end of the conveyor 4 to receive the falling wire ring, and the supply device 5 also supplies coil end face protection material to the convergence tab 6. be.
第3図は保護材供給装置5の詳細を示すもので、搬送コ
ンベア4の終端側、に該コンベアとほぼ平行にガイドプ
レート7を設け、該プレート7の先端は線材リングの落
下を案内するガイド筒8に形成した保護材供給口9位置
に取付けられている。FIG. 3 shows the details of the protective material supply device 5, in which a guide plate 7 is provided on the terminal end side of the conveyor 4, almost parallel to the conveyor, and the tip of the plate 7 is a guide for guiding the fall of the wire ring. It is attached to the protective material supply port 9 formed in the tube 8.
また、該ガイドプレート、7の後端側には押出シリンダ
10によって進退する先端弧状にした保護林押出板11
が設置されており、さらにガイドプレート7の中間には
前記押出板11によって一枚づつ押出される保護材を貯
留する筒状の収納室12が設けられ、該収納室12はガ
イドプレート7と交差する方向に延びる保護材落下シュ
ート12′と連設されている。Further, on the rear end side of the guide plate 7, a protected forest extrusion plate 11 having an arc-shaped tip that moves forward and backward by an extrusion cylinder 10 is provided.
A cylindrical storage chamber 12 is provided in the middle of the guide plate 7 to store the protective material extruded one by one by the extrusion plate 11, and the storage chamber 12 intersects with the guide plate 7. It is connected to a protective material falling chute 12' extending in the direction shown in FIG.
また、前記収納室12と保護材供給口9との間のガイド
プレート7には一対の保護林挟持用ローラーの、下側の
ローラー13が出没する開口14が形成され、該保護林
挟持用ローラー13は減速機15を介してモータ16に
接続され、保護材けり出しのため回動する。Furthermore, an opening 14 is formed in the guide plate 7 between the storage chamber 12 and the protective material supply port 9, through which the lower roller 13 of a pair of protected forest pinching rollers appears. 13 is connected to a motor 16 via a speed reducer 15, and rotates to eject the protective material.
第2図および第3図に示す供給装置を用いた線材コイル
の集束操作について第4図イ〜ホにしたがって説明する
。The focusing operation of the wire coil using the feeding device shown in FIGS. 2 and 3 will be explained in accordance with FIGS. 4A to 4E.
まず、落下シュート12′から保護林17を収納室12
内に送給し貯留させると共に、押出シリンダ10を動作
させて押出板11によって一枚の保護林17Aをガイド
プレート7上の保護林挟持用ローラー13位置まで押出
す(第4図イ。First, the protected forest 17 is sent to the storage room 12 from the falling chute 12'.
At the same time, the extrusion cylinder 10 is operated to push out a piece of protected forest 17A by the extrusion plate 11 to the position of the protected forest holding roller 13 on the guide plate 7 (FIG. 4A).
口)。mouth).
次いで、モータ16を動作させガイドプレート7下に引
込んでいた一対の下側の保護林挟持用ローラー13を開
口14に露出させ、上側の保護林挟持用ローラー13と
共に回転さ保護材17Aをガイド筒8の供給口9から内
方へけり出す(第4図へ)。Next, the motor 16 is operated to expose the pair of lower protected forest clamping rollers 13 that had been retracted under the guide plate 7 through the opening 14, and rotate together with the upper protected forest clamping roller 13 to move the protective material 17A into the guide cylinder. 8 inward from the supply port 9 (see Figure 4).
けり出された保護材17Aはガイド筒8下方に待機して
いた集束タブ6下部にはまり込みセットされ、次に、線
材リング18の落下が朋始される(第4図二)。The protective material 17A that has been kicked out is set by fitting into the lower part of the focusing tab 6 that is waiting below the guide cylinder 8, and then the wire ring 18 begins to fall (FIG. 4-2).
集束タブ6周囲に落下集積された線材コイル19はその
下端面を保護林17Aに接触しており、所定の線材リン
グ18の集積が終了したなら、次に前記保護林17Aの
供給と同様な操作により、二枚目の保護材17Bの供給
が行われ、該保護材17Bは集束された線材コイル19
の上端面に接する(第4図ホ)。The wire rod coils 19 dropped and accumulated around the collecting tab 6 have their lower end surfaces in contact with the protected forest 17A, and when the predetermined accumulation of wire rod rings 18 is completed, the same operation as that for supplying the protected forest 17A is performed next. As a result, the second protective material 17B is supplied, and this protective material 17B is attached to the bundled wire coil 19.
(Fig. 4 E).
このようにして両端面に保護林17A、17Bを当接し
た状態で線材コイル19の集束が行われた後、適宜検査
、秤量工程に移行し、結束フープ材にて保護材と共に集
束コイルを結束する。After the wire rod coil 19 is bundled with the protective forests 17A and 17B in contact with both end faces in this way, the process moves to an appropriate inspection and weighing process, and the bundled coil is bound together with the protective material using a binding hoop material. do.
結束後の線材コイルは第5図に示す通りであり、コイル
両端面が保護林17A、17Bによって防護されている
ため、フープ材との接触疵、コイル相互とこすれによる
疵、フックの突掛は疵等の発生が防止される。The wire rod coil after bundling is as shown in Fig. 5, and since both end faces of the coil are protected by the protective forest 17A and 17B, there are no contact scratches with the hoop material, scratches due to the coils rubbing against each other, and hook protrusions. Occurrence of scratches etc. is prevented.
本考案においては上記の如くコイル下端面を被覆するた
めの保護材は、必らず最初の線材リングが集束タブ6に
落下する以前に、該タブ6にセットされていることが必
要であるが、第2図および第3図の如く集束タブ6を所
定の位置に静置してから保護林17をタブ6に落下せし
めてセットする方法以外に、他の場所で予めタブ6に下
端側保護材をセットしておき、しかる後該タブ6を所定
位置に移行させることもできる。In the present invention, as described above, the protective material for covering the lower end surface of the coil must be set on the focusing tab 6 before the first wire ring falls onto the focusing tab 6. In addition to the method of placing the focusing tab 6 in a predetermined position and then dropping the protective forest 17 onto the tab 6 as shown in FIGS. It is also possible to set the material and then move the tab 6 to a predetermined position.
また、保護林17のセットはすべて自動供給装置に依存
する方法に限らず、場合によっては自動供給装置と作業
具の人力を組合わせることも可能である。Furthermore, the setting of the protected forest 17 is not limited to a method that relies entirely on an automatic feeding device, but depending on the case, it is also possible to combine an automatic feeding device and manual labor of working tools.
一方、保護林17については図では中央に集束タブ6に
入り込むに充分な径の穴を有するドーナツ状の円形板を
示したが、本考案では保護林17の形状はこれに限らず
他の任意の形状とすることができる。On the other hand, the protected forest 17 is shown as a donut-shaped circular plate having a hole in the center with a diameter sufficient to fit into the focusing tab 6, but in the present invention, the shape of the protected forest 17 is not limited to this. It can be in the shape of
例えば、第6図イに示すように円形保護板に径方向およ
び周方向液部を交互に付与したもの、第6図口に示す如
く全体をきく形に形成したもの、あるいは第6図へに示
すようにコイル端面のみならず側面までも被覆するに充
分な大きさのものなどが考えられる。For example, as shown in Figure 6A, a circular protective plate with radial and circumferential liquid parts alternately provided, a circular protective plate with the entire part formed into a rectangular shape as shown in the opening of Figure 6, or As shown in the figure, one that is large enough to cover not only the end face of the coil but also the side face can be considered.
以上説明したように本考案の集束装置によれば、線材集
束時の疵発生を大幅に低減することが可能であり、かつ
コイル荷姿の改善にもつながり、その実用的効果は非常
に大きい。As explained above, according to the convergence device of the present invention, it is possible to significantly reduce the occurrence of flaws during convergence of the wire, and it also leads to an improvement in the appearance of the coil packaging, which has a very large practical effect.
また、本考案の工程は線材圧延工程、線材熱処理工程お
よび集束工程と続くオンライン線材製造工程に対し、支
障なく容易に組み込むことができ、品質保証の面で寄与
するところ大である。Furthermore, the process of the present invention can be easily incorporated into the online wire manufacturing process, which follows the wire rolling process, wire heat treatment process, and convergence process, without any problems, and greatly contributes to quality assurance.
